About Autodesk Inc

Founded in 1982, Autodesk is an application software company that serves industries in architecture, engineering, and construction.

About Halliburton Company

Halliburton is one of the three largest oilfield service firms in the world, offering superior expertise in a number of business lines, including completion fluids, wireline services, cementing, and countless others. It's the number one pressure pumper in North America, and has been a leading innovator in hydraulic fracturing over the last two decades.
